Transaction 43f26baae2995249e8c1b40975cd8e884a7e73a5e022b8b3714dd7ccbd424f63

1 Input
2 Outputs
  • 43f26baae2995249e8c1b40975cd8e884a7e73a5e022b8b3714dd7ccbd424f63:0
  • value  2045000
    address  3Q6kVk54Xn3AYrpf5DMphKXq3kSHrUm5yi
  • 43f26baae2995249e8c1b40975cd8e884a7e73a5e022b8b3714dd7ccbd424f63:1
  • value  492866080
    address  35CxXcrxxSecBRiCbXCNidKYG8rfkPsiuZ